## VramScope Environments

VramScope profiles GPU memory allocation across the Tessellate rendering service in all three environments. Support staff should note that staging uses half-size allocation pools, so profiles captured there will not match production peaks. Always confirm which environment a customer trace came from before comparing numbers. The active configuration values for the production profiler are listed below.

service settings:
PRAWYN_PIN=9848
PRAWYN_METRICS_HOST=metrics.prawyn.lumicworks.corp
PRAWYN_LOG_LEVEL=warn
PRAWYN_TENANT=pelius

**Key Ceremony Checklist — Item 7: ChipGate Reader Signing Key**

Before approving the ceremony record, confirm that the signing key for the ChipGate marathon timing-chip reader firmware was generated on the air-gapped laptop, that both witnesses initialed the log sheet, and that the sealed envelope count matches the roster. The reviewer then verifies the escrow copy can be restored: open the escrow volume on the ceremony machine and enter the recovery passphrase recorded below.

vault phrase of bagaf-kajeg = jorath-feniel-briir-siliel-ralix

**☐ Brief new starter on weekend lift maintenance.** The facilities desk must explain that Ashfell Plaza runs lift servicing every Sunday morning, meaning the main cars are offline from 06:00 to noon. Confirm the starter knows the route to the west stairwell, including the fire-door signage on level 2, and note that the goods lift is staff-only during this window. Issue the weekend stairwell pass code, which should be recorded below.

badge for yagep-fahog: bdg-HBHYH-29021

Ticket #— Floor 9 Opening Prep, Brindlemoor House

Hi facilities folks, Floor 9 opens to staff next Monday and we need a few things squared away before then. Lift access is live, but the two side doors by the kitchenette are still on the old lock config — please reprogram them before Friday. Also, signage for the quiet rooms hasn't arrived, so pop up the temporary printed ones for now. Until the badge readers sync, the interim door code for Floor 9 is below.

door code, bajop-bajog: bdg-DSWAC-43621